Extended 4K60Hz Monitor Support for Mac, PC, and Chromebook: Enhance your productivity and multitasking capabilities with Hyper’s travel accessories. By providing a spacious and immersive workspace, this USB-C hub allows users to simultaneously view and work on multiple high-resolution content, such as videos, images, documents, and applications, with smooth and crisp visuals.
Transfer Data at 2X Speeds with 10Gbps USB 3.2: Enables lightning-fast data transfer, allowing users to move large files from any portable storage drive, backup data, and sync devices in a fraction of the time compared to traditional USB connections, increasing productivity and efficiency.
Transfer Photos and Video at 3X Speeds with 312MB/s SD and microSD 4.0: Provides significant time savings for video editing and photography workflows, as this USB-C hub is a travel gear that allows for ultra-fast and efficient transfer of high-resolution images and videos, enabling seamless editing, quicker file backups, and accelerated post-production processes.
40% More Pass-through Charging Power with 140W PD 3.1: Power and charge your devices up to 125W with a 140W PD 3.1 Charger* while using this mini travel item, ensuring uninterrupted productivity, making it ideal for power-hungry devices and busy professionals on the go. *When connected to PD 3.1 Host
Recycled Materials: This travel-sized essential features faster speeds and built better for the planet with 100% recycled aluminum and 85% recycled plastic

Finally found it!
After hours of research and an embarrassing number of returns, this is the hub I’m keeping. I was on the hunt for what I thought was simple, an adapter with HDMI, 2 USB-C data ports, and at least one legacy USB port. To my amazement, most adapters take an “everything but the kitchen sink” approach and add an insane amount of ports making the hub huge. And to top it off, they almost all only have 1 USB-C port capable of data if at any. I also ran into lots of issue with the quality of the HDMI on other hubs. This hub checks all the boxes. It’s incredibly small, the HDMI supports full 4K 60hz HDR, and all 3 USB ports support super high speed data. The USB-C ports also fully support audio passthrough, so I can use wired headphones with a USB-C dongle! I tested everything on both my M2 MacBook Air and my iPhone 15 Pro and all features work perfectly on both. Sometimes you really do get what you pay for!
